## SEC. 5102 WOMEN VETERANS RETROFIT INITIATIVE **[**[38 U.S.C. 8110 note](/us/usc/t38/s8110)**]** ###
(a)In General The Secretary of Veterans Affairs shall prioritize the retrofitting of existing medical facilities of the Department of Veterans Affairs with fixtures, materials, and other outfitting measures to support the provision of care to women veterans at such facilities. ###
(b)Plan ####
(1)In general Not later than one year after the date of the enactment of this Act, the Secretary shall submit to Congress, the Committee on Veterans’ Affairs of the Senate, and the Committee on Veterans’ Affairs of the House of Representatives a plan to address deficiencies in environment of care for women veterans at medical facilities of the Department. ####
(2)Elements The plan required by paragraph
(1)shall include the following: #####
(A)An explanation of the specific environment of care deficiencies that need correcting. #####
(B)An assessment of how the Secretary prioritizes retrofitting existing medical facilities to support provision of care to women veterans in comparison to other requirements. #####
(C)A five-year strategic plan and cost projection for retrofitting medical facilities of the Department to support the provision of care to women veterans as required under subsection (a). ###
(c)Authorization of Appropriations Subject to appropriations and the plan under (b), there is authorized to be appropriated to the Secretary $20,000,000 to carry out subsection
(a)in addition to amounts otherwise made available to the Secretary for the purposes set forth in such subsection.
